Willy does respect me now. Not sure if it will carry over to his adoptive home. He pretty much ignores Dad, lol, but then most of us in this house do. Oops, did I say that? Ha ha haaaa.
He grumbles if he doesn't want to do what I ask, but it is not that low deep I MEAN IT growl from when he arrived; and while mumbling, he does what I ask. He LOVES getting treats, so that helps a LOT. He will do what I ask and . . . run to the fridge for a bit of hot dog. Silly boy!
He is going to need a home with someone who can maintain the commands, and keep him active mentally. He needs to progress through 2 more classes and get into Agility! At his age he won't be competitive at it, but he needs the constant mental stimulation. He is far too smart and it gets him into trouble when he is bored.
He is definitely NOT the dog who arrived here July 15th!
